Job Title : Program and Budget Support Senior Consultant

Work Location : Pentagon, on-site daily

Security Clearance : Secret

Agency : U.S. Department of Defense (DoD)

Office supported : Office of the Under Secretary of Defense (Comptroller) (OUSD(C))

Salary Target : 125-135K; 1099 -105hr

Position Overview

BizFirst is supporting our client in search of an experienced Program and Budget Support Senior Consultant to provide program and financial management support within the Department of Defense, with a strong focus on financial data analysis, reporting, and system integration. Responsibilities include reprogramming and funds transfers, data collection and integration, development of reports and briefings, reconciliation of financial information, and support for financial execution.

This role works extensively with the DoD Advanced Analytics (Advana) platform and supports PPBE processes through financial analysis, visualization, and the development of executive-level dashboards using Power BI. Additional responsibilities include coordinating RFIs, supporting audits, and assisting with congressional reporting. The position is onsite at the Pentagon in Arlington, Virginia and requires an active Secret clearance or higher.

Our client is a specialized management consulting firm that supports the federal government with program execution, financial management, analytics, and budget operations across the Department of Defense. Through their work with senior leadership and mission teams, they provide support for financial reporting, data integration, and enterprise-level decision-making for military departments and defense agencies.

Key Responsibilities

  • Prepare and review reprogramming and funds transfer actions within DoD
  • Provide support with the collection, integration, analysis, and visualization of financial data, including data calls and the development of reports, briefings, and dashboards
  • Support the submission quality check process for all financial information and coordinate with agencies to resolve data discrepancies
  • Review monthly financial data; monitor, reconcile, and report data against plans, forecasts, and budget targets to perform analysis and generate summary and detail reports and executive-level information papers
  • Perform support and analysis activities to document financial execution for budget accounts overseen by OUSD(C) and design and test financial data integration into the DoD Advanced Analytics (Advana) platform
  • Develop and maintain Power BI dashboards and reporting solutions to support leadership decision-making
  • Assist with the distribution and consolidation of Requests for Information (RFIs) from internal and external organizations
  • Assist with the development of Standard Operating Procedures (SOPs), manage budget exhibit printing, and support ongoing PPBE reform efforts
  • Provide support in compiling data and information for audit closure and timely submission of congressional reports
